What is Police Simulator?




Police Simulator is a simulation game that was released in November 2022 for PC, P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, and Xbox Series XS. The game was developed by Aesir Interactive and published by astragon Entertainment. The game allows you to create your own police officer character and choose from different modes, districts, neighborhoods, missions, tools, vehicles, and features.


A simulation game that lets you join the police force of a fictional American city




The game is set in Brighton, a fictitious American city that is inspired by real-life locations such as Boston, New York City, Chicago, Los Angeles, San Francisco, Miami Beach. You can join the Brighton Police Department (BPD) as a patrol officer and work your way up to higher ranks and responsibilities. You can also customize your appearance, uniform, badge number, name tag.


A dynamic and open world with various missions, events, and challenges




The game features a dynamic traffic system that organically creates traffic flows and car accidents. You can also encounter random emergency situations that require your immediate response. For example, you might have to deal with a robbery, a fire, a domestic dispute, a missing person, or a hostage situation. You can also accept various missions from your dispatcher or your colleagues, such as ticketing, accidents, arrests, undercover, and more. Each mission has different objectives, difficulties, and outcomes.

Police Simulator is easy to play, but hard to master. You can start by choosing your mode, district, neighborhood, and patrol. Then, you can follow the instructions and complete the tasks assigned to you. You can also earn points, XP, and stars to unlock new features and rewards.


Choose your mode: Simulation or Casual




The game offers two modes: Simulation and Casual. Simulation mode is more realistic and challenging. You have to follow the rules and regulations of the police force and the city. You have to respect the rights and dignity of the people. You have to be careful not to break the law, make mistakes, or lose conduct points. Casual mode is more relaxed and forgiving. You can bend the rules and regulations of the police force and the city. You can be more aggressive and assertive with the people. You can get away with breaking the law, making mistakes, or losing conduct points.


Select your district and neighborhood for your patrol




The game features a large and lively city with three unique districts and several neighborhoods. Each district has its own characteristics, challenges, and opportunities. The districts are: Downtown, Suburbs, and Industrial. The neighborhoods are: Chinatown, Little Italy, Financial District, University Campus, Shopping Mall, Trailer Park, Airport, Harbor, and more. You can select your district and neighborhood for your patrol based on your preference, rank, availability, and reputation.
